Training

All assembly and manufacturing personnel take part in the IKE Micro Skill Matrix. All job descriptions are clearly defined and each job description has certain levels that can be attained by each operator. Operators can move up in levels with formal training, job experience and improved skills. They must pass all defined guidelines before moving up a level. All cleanroom and Quality Control personnel are certified to MIL-STD 883 assembly guidelines and cleanroom protocol. All SMT, hand soldering personnel, and Quality Control personnel are certified to IPC-A-610, Classes 1,2, 3. All manufacturing personnel receive formal ESD training. Re-certifications are done every two years.


Continuous Improvement

After many successes and our share of failures, we focus on the most important areas for continuous improvement. Each of these target areas contains a whole host of initiatives needed for us to improve our performance. We capture data on internal rework, customer returns, on-time delivery, and individual job productivity. By providing an open forum for communication and by quantifying variances, we continually make progress in the right direction. Our customers have also been a great source for continuous improvement. We have been able to incorporate many "best practice" policies and Six Sigma initiatives that have been successful in their organizations.
